Glaisher has uploaded a new change for review.

  https://gerrit.wikimedia.org/r/181992

Change subject: Redirect Main_[Pp]age to Wikidata:Main_Page
......................................................................

Redirect Main_[Pp]age to Wikidata:Main_Page

There are incoming links from other wikis to Main Page
at wikidata.org. However, due to the extension's restrictions
it is not possible to create normal mediawiki redirect
pages at ns0 at Wikidata. Therefore, we need this to make
it work. Local links to [[Main Page]] would lead to
Wikidata:Main Page's view mode, (instead of edit mode)
due to mediawiki's redlink=1 feature.

Bug: T58258
Change-Id: I34a93ca7705d16d6f32d8ec178ef8fcb3cd04abc
---
M modules/mediawiki/files/apache/sites/main.conf
1 file changed, 4 insertions(+), 0 deletions(-)


  git pull ssh://gerrit.wikimedia.org:29418/operations/puppet 
refs/changes/92/181992/1

diff --git a/modules/mediawiki/files/apache/sites/main.conf 
b/modules/mediawiki/files/apache/sites/main.conf
index 47efb6f..26bee23 100644
--- a/modules/mediawiki/files/apache/sites/main.conf
+++ b/modules/mediawiki/files/apache/sites/main.conf
@@ -131,6 +131,10 @@
     # https://meta.wikimedia.org/wiki/Wikidata/Notes/URI_scheme
     RewriteRule ^/entity/(.*)$ 
https://www.wikidata.org/wiki/Special:EntityData/$1 [R=303,QSA]
 
+    # Redirect Main_[Pp]age to Wikidata:Main_Page - T58258
+    RewriteRule ^/wiki/Main_[Pp]age(.*)$ /wiki/Wikidata:Main_Page$1 
[R=301,L,NE]
+    RewriteRule ^/w/index\.php\?title=Main_[Pp]age(.*)$ 
/w/index.php?title=Wikidata:Main_Page$1 [R=301,L,NE]
+
     # Configurable favicon
     RewriteRule ^/favicon\.ico$ /w/favicon.php [L]
 

-- 
To view, visit https://gerrit.wikimedia.org/r/181992
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: newchange
Gerrit-Change-Id: I34a93ca7705d16d6f32d8ec178ef8fcb3cd04abc
Gerrit-PatchSet: 1
Gerrit-Project: operations/puppet
Gerrit-Branch: production
Gerrit-Owner: Glaisher <[email protected]>

_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to